Quérénaing (French pronunciation: [keʁenɛ̃]) is a commune in the Nord department in northern France.[3]

Heraldry

Arms of Quérénaing
Arms of Quérénaing
The arms of Quérénaing are blazoned :

Or, a cross engrailed gules. (Artres, Bettrechies, Cerfontaine, Denain, Eth, Lesquin, Obies, Quérénaing, Semousies, Wambrechies and Warlaing use the same arms.)
